It has been around six years since
One Tree Hill went off the air - and we'll admit, we definitely miss it.
The drama followed the lives (and extensive rivalry) between half-brothers Lucas and Nathan Scott as they vied for a spot on their high school's basketball team.
As the show went on, the focus began to shift to the relationships, drama and the brothers' day-to-day lives - and how they ultimately left their rivalry behind and formed a solid bond.
The rumour mill went into overdrive about a possible
One Tree Hill reunion this week after a number of cast members confirmed they were working on a mystery project.
Hilarie Burton, Danneel Ackles, Robert Buckley and Antwon Tanner - aka: Peyton Sawyer, Rachel Gatina, Clay Evans and Antwon 'Skills' Taylor - shared behind-the-scenes photos from the "new project" on social media.
Only...the posts were soon deleted.
Fortunately, not before the eagle-eyed social media users were able to get screenshots.

However, it looks like it's genuinely for a new project.
There's no hints that other cast members, like Bethany Joy Lenz, Chad Michael Murray, James Lafferty and Sophia Bush, are involved in the mysterious festive project - although
TVGuide report both Sophia and Bethany 'liked' Hillarie's post.
In the wake of the photos, a number of screenshots with conversations between Hilarie Burton and Robert Buckley talking about doing a Christmas movie together have resurfaced.
